Bayer Yakuhin Reports Nearly 20% Drop in Operating Profit Despite Growth in Sales of Zetia
Bayer Yakuhin has reported its settlement of accounts for 2012. The company recorded sales of 170,789 million yen (-1.1% from the previous year), an operating profit of 18,963 million yen (-19.0%), an ordinary profit of 18,677 million yen (-19.3%), and…
